High-Precision Optical Wedge Prism
This optical wedge prism is engineered for precise beam steering, deviation, and dispersion in demanding optical systems. Fabricated from BK7 grade A glass, it offers superior clarity and minimal wavefront distortion for laser, spectroscopic, and metrological applications. With its high surface quality and tight manufacturing tolerances, this component ensures predictable performance and reliable integration into scientific and industrial instruments.
